David Crosby Safe Energy Fundraiser
updated: Mar 29, 2016, 9:26 PM
By Robert Bernstein

David Crosby performed a fundraiser concert at the Granada Theater on March 22.

Here are my photos as well as VIP reception photos from Kim Byrnes Photography. Courtesy of the World Business Academy.

The event was sponsored by the World Business Academy (WBA) to raise money for their Safe Energy Project. The WBA claims that the Diablo Canyon nuclear power plant creates a down wind zone of increased cancer and other negative health effects. Strontium 90 is claimed to be the cause. They want to prevent the plant from receiving a renewal license.

But they also want to promote sustainable, renewable energy. Their goal is to create a micro-grid for the Santa Barbara area. It would be powered by renewable sources such as solar and wind. And it would protect our electric power in the case of the fragile main grid power lines failing in an earthquake, flood or fire. The money raised at this event will go toward the logistics of setting up this renewable micro grid.

Below are notes I took in the dark during the concert! They are a bit cryptic and unedited, but I hope some people will find some treasures in there!

I have highlighted the titles of songs David Crosby performed. The rest are his comments and/or my observations!



Started right on time at 7:30

"Tracks in the Dust"

I am an irresponsible person

"The Lee Shore"

I write weird sh-t in strange tunings.

"Naked In The Rain"

Rumors of his psychedelic era. Watching a weird guy. He appeared as an Indian Chief. Changed. Weird colors. Seeing his past lives. Like flipping through book pages.

He likes Joni Mitchell

Jango is his son

"He Played Real Good For Free Lyrics"

Keyboard players are snotty

You grow up. You have kids. You treasure them. They get smart. You try to answer their questions. They ask about Trump. WTF? How am I going to explain it?

The next song reputedly got me thrown out of the Byrds. Not true. Just that I am an a--hole.

This song is really just a love song.

"Triad"

It involves him and two women. In fact, he has been happily married to his wife Jan for 39 years. Not common in this industry.

"Thousand Roads"

He says he has friends here. From the World Business Academy. They want to build a micro-grid for Santa Barbara. From renewable energy.

The Diablo Canyon nuclear plant must be closed. It was built on earthquake faults. It produces waste with no place to put it. And it is a terrorist target. He is a pilot and knows how easy it would be to fly a small plane over it.

Crosby noted his first job was as an usher here in the Granada Theater! He introduces John Gonzales who brings out an endless stream of guitars for him.

The next two songs are a question and an answer

"Where Will I Be?" is the question

"Page 43" is the answer

"Carry Me"

It was now 8:30PM. He said he normally would go out and smoke a joint at this point. He used to think that would make him perform better. He realized it had the opposite effect. So, he will just go out and get some fresh air!




He had to watch "Psycho" 13 times. Not his kind of movie.

His song writing start was with the Byrds.

"Everybody's Been Burned"

Nobody else has to explain their songs. Not even Bob!

When Bob Dylan met Crosby's wife Jan, Bob kissed Jan's hand.

Dylan wanted Crosby to play along with him on a recording. But he would not let Crosby hear the song or know anything about it first! Crosby insisted. Dylan played it. But when it came time to record, Crosby swears it was a different song!

"Rusty and Blue"

Crosby likes that the words just come to him. That he can do it all by himself. Otherwise you are duking it out with the bass player, etc.

Suddenly, he says, "Let's talk politics!" He said he has a low opinion of most people in politics. Surprisingly, he said he liked Eisenhower.

Someone shouts out "Bernie". He said he likes Bernie Sanders! He likes that Bernie is feisty.

He said he is not fond of either party. He said it is time for a woman president. He thinks a woman president would allocate more money for schools.

But he never actually said he endorsed Hillary and never said her name. In person at the VIP reception he told me he is 100% for Bernie Sanders! It seems the "woman president" thing was a more vague, longer term desire.

Crosby liked that Eisenhower warned of the power of the Military Industrial Complex. As a military general, he knew. The military suppliers buy Congress. Congress starts the wars that give them the money for their next campaigns.

He wrote a song about this. "It did no F-ing good!"

But he went ahead and sang it: "What Are Their Names"

They hate it when you vote. They want you stupid, buying things.

He noted that many of his songs talk of "dreams". Funny thing is he can't actually remember his own dreams.

"In My Dreams"

He said his life is all about family and songs.

His new album is called "Lighthouse". He played a bit from that.

He remembered back to when he went to England with the Byrds. He was so thrilled to meet the Beatles. And the Beatles were very kind to them. Crosby especially connected with George. He gave George a Ravi Shankar album. George told Crosby later that this simple act led to the Beatles becoming so interested in India. To them going there and adopting Indian music into their own music.

Crosby was honored that he had such an impact. But he wondered about the whole guru thing. He wanted to repeat the Bob Dylan line, "Don't follow leaders. Watch the parkin' meters."

He realized that he had not sung many songs most of the crowd would know. He then sang "Deja Vu" which was indeed the first song I recognized! This was almost two hours into the concert!

He talked about his affair with Joni Mitchell. He said it was turbulent. Like falling into a cement mixer. He repeated again how happy he has been to be with his wife Jan now for 39 years.

He then played "Guinnevere" which he says he regularly sings to Jan.

After two hours, he still came back for a short encore of two songs.

One song many people think is about a train robbery. He said it is actually about the breakup of Crosby, Stills, Nash and Young.

And his finale was "Cowboy Movie".
